<p style="text-align: justify;">Yes, NTA provides different JEE Mains question paper in each shift every day. The question paper of each shift is different from the previous shift/day. However, on any given day and shift, all students appearing in the JEE Mains across the centres receives the same question paper but their order of questions is different so that no two students receive the same set of question paper. This is done to avoid any chance of cheating in the exam.</p>

<p>No. The JEE Advanced exam is held in computer based test mode and after the exam, candidates will not be given any hardcopy of the questions as asked in the exam. However, the official question papers are uploaded on the official website, jeeadv.ac.in, a few hours after the exam is over in all shifts. Candidates can access the official website and download and save the JEE Advanced question paper PDF.</p>

<p>NTR University of Health Sciences (NTRUHS) accepts NEET UG scores for admission to MBBS courses. NEET UG is a national-level entrance exam conducted by the National Testing Agency (NTA) for admission to undergraduate medical courses in India. Candidates who have qualified for NEET UG are eligible to apply for admission to MBBS courses at NTRUHS. Moreover, the university accepts the counselling process of NEET/ Andhra Pradesh NEET and Telangana NEET.&nbsp;</p>

<p>Yes, School of Technology PDEU conducts a Written Admission Test for MSc programme. The school conducts WAT in offline mode comprising 50 multiple choice questions of 100 marks. The final selection to MSc programme is based on performance of the candidates in UG final exam, written test and personal interview round. The maximum weightage of 50% is given to UG final exam score.</p>
